
Welcome to the Wisconsin Section of the American Society of Agricultural and Biological Engineers (ASABE). Our organization's goal is to foster relationships and professional development in the agricultural and biological engineering community.
To facilitate our member's professional development, we hold professional meetings throughout the year, organize industry tours, host invited speakers, engage with the pre-professional groups at UW-Madison and UW-River Falls, and recognize member contributions to our field.
Our vision it to be among the global leaders providing engineering and technology solutions ensuring a healthy environment and a sustainable world with ample food, water, fiber and energy.
